代码之家  ›  专栏  ›  技术社区  ›  Gauthier Delvaulx

在macOS上查找git存储库

  •  0
  • Gauthier Delvaulx  · 技术社区  · 6 年前

    我想找到我在mac上创建的Git存储库的位置。有没有办法找到,例如, albatrocity/git-version-control.markdown 在macOS上使用终端?我用默认参数安装了所有东西。我想一定是在 User 目录,但我在那里找不到任何与GitHub相关的内容。

    当我找到它时,我想将其完全移除,以进行“正确”的安装。

    编辑: sudo find / -name "parsing.py" -print 我使用了一个文件,我知道终端显示时包含的文件夹 sudo find / -wholename "*albatrocity/git-version-control.markdown"

    2 回复  |  直到 6 年前
        1
  •  0
  •   Ronan Boiteau    6 年前

    您可以使用 find -wholename 根据文件名和文件夹查找文件的选项:

    find <directory> -wholename "*albatrocity/git-version-control.markdown"
    

    例如,如果要在 /Users/ 目录:

    find /Users/ -wholename "*albatrocity/git-version-control.markdown"
    
        2
  •  -1
  •   user unknown    6 年前

    如果您在mac上有locate,并且有一个定期运行的updatedb,那么locate可能会快得多:

    locate albatrocity | grep git-version-control.markdown
    

    它使用哈希表快速访问文件名,但如果数据库没有定期更新或文件太年轻(通常不到一天),则可能会过期。

    如果这没有成功,那么我会使用find进行全面搜索,但可能会将其限制在一条可能的狭窄路径上。